As Seqana scales, we are looking for a highly capable Senior Data Product Manager to serve as the critical bridge between market needs and our advanced technical execution. This role carries a dual mandate: driving product maturity by scaling and hardening our existing data product portfolio, and accelerating strategic growth by independently owning significant growth pillars and new product opportunities.

What you'll do

  • Translating strategic business objectives into clear system requirements and actionable user stories, ensuring technical blueprints align with scalable architectures.
  • Take end-to-end ownership of specific segments within our existing product portfolio, overseeing the entire lifecycle from initial discovery through to successful delivery and maintenance.
  • For new, unstandardized workflows and features, operate seamlessly in 'Discovery Mode' alongside Tech, prioritizing rapid testing and iteration.
  • Work closely with the Chief Product Officer to explore and validate new product opportunities, expanding Seqana's market presence and scaling our overall climate impact.
  • Own internal dashboard products by defining business requirements and metrics that enable data-driven technical strategy, sales narratives, and model performance evaluation.

What you'll need

  • STEM degree or comparable professional experience in a technical setting.
  • At least 4 years spent managing products, with a proven ability to lead and scale technical products.
  • Proficiency in day-to-day operations, including crafting actionable user stories, overseeing backlogs, and setting long-term measurable outcomes (OKRs/KPIs).
  • Strong verbal and written skills, specifically the knack for making scientific and data-heavy concepts accessible.
  • Ability to thrive in an ambiguous, entrepreneurial environment where priorities can shift between long-term vision and rapid delivery.
  • Proficient in English.

Nice to have

  • Direct experience or familiarity with Machine Learning, geospatial data, Earth Observation (EO), remote sensing, or process based models.
  • Practical knowledge of applied statistics.
  • Prior experience in the AgTech, Carbon Market, or agricultural supply chains.
  • Familiarity with Python, CLI-based workflows, and dashboarding tools.
